Transaction

4e9755fcbfad113b166920241653970fa9b4510f6121aa50ed09f4565ce4b84e

Summary

In Block1017364
TimeSat, 28 Dec 2024 14:28:30 UTC
Total Input20107.04700041 Nebula
Total Output20128.04700041 Nebula
Fees0 Nebula

Details

CoinStake TX0 Nebula ×
Rn5pcX28Fg1W5UQZ4ReEXdQxpJkf5MVfh420118.59700041 Nebula
RqyQzpaEPs5smW2phen8sw7eruEwrBZxaw9.45 Nebula
Fee: 0 Nebula
4760 Confirmations20128.04700041 Nebula
Raw Transaction